AKWA IBOM GOVERNMENT SPENDS TEN BILLION NAIRA ON GRANTS TO 7,688 INDIGENES
The Akwa Ibom State Government has disbursed 10 billion naira in grants to 7,688 beneficiaries across the state’s 10 federal constituencies.
Governor Umo Eno disclosed this at the weekend during the grand finale of the six-month Town Square Meeting/Empowerment Series in Etinan Federal Constituency.
The grants, targeted at indigenes engaged in agriculture, trading, transportation, and equipment acquisition, were allocated via the state’s ARISE portal to ensure equal access.
The empowerment series began in Abak with 833 beneficiaries and continued in Oron, Eket, Ikot Ekpene, Ikot Abasi, Ukanafun, Itu, Uyo, and Ikono, culminating in Etinan where 844 residents received grants totaling 361.45 million naira.
Governor Eno emphasized transparency and fairness, stating that no slots were given to individuals.
He urged youths to register on the ARISE portal to benefit from government initiatives, including employment and procurement opportunities.
